  • England takes second victory over France

    A double from Matt Daly, Barry Middleton’s 25th goal for England and Ashley Jackson’s well placed penalty corner inside ten minutes helped England to a comfortable 4-0 victory over France in the second game of a two match series at Bisham Abbey. More

    Netherlands claim BDO Junior World Cup title

    Netherlands is the new BDO Junior World Cup Champion. The Dutch formation defeated Argentina in the final (3-0) in Boston, USA. Korea claimed the bronze after defeating England (2-1). More
